文章标题:ECC在今天的密码学中是否仍然有价值?
随着密码学技术的不断发展,各种加密算法层出不穷,其中椭圆曲线密码学(ECC)因其高效性和安全性受到了广泛关注。那么,在今天的密码学中,ECC是否仍然具有价值呢?本文将从以下几个方面进行探讨。
一、ECC的特点与优势
1. 高效性:与传统的公钥加密算法(如RSA)相比,ECC在相同的密钥长度下,ECC的加密和解密速度更快,计算效率更高。
2. 安全性:ECC的理论基础较为坚实,具有较好的抗量子计算攻击能力,能够抵御量子计算机的潜在威胁。
3. 资源消耗:ECC在计算过程中对计算资源和存储空间的要求较低,适用于资源受限的设备。
4. 密钥长度:ECC的密钥长度较短,相对于RSA等算法,可以在保证安全性的前提下,降低密钥管理的难度。
二、ECC在今天的密码学中的价值
1. 安全性:在量子计算机的威胁下,ECC具有较强的抗量子计算能力,保证了信息传输的安全性。
2. 高效性:随着网络速度的提高,对加密算法的效率要求越来越高,ECC在此方面具有明显优势。
3. 资源消耗:在资源受限的设备上,ECC可以减少计算资源和存储空间的需求,提高设备性能。
4. 应用领域:ECC在移动通信、物联网、云计算等领域得到了广泛应用,有助于推动相关技术的发展。
综上所述,ECC在今天的密码学中仍然具有很高的价值。尽管存在其他新兴加密算法,但ECC在安全性、高效性和资源消耗方面的优势使其在密码学领域具有不可替代的地位。
常见问题清单:
1. 什么是ECC?
2. ECC与RSA相比有哪些优势?
3. ECC的安全性如何?
4. ECC在量子计算机威胁下是否安全?
5. ECC的密钥长度为什么较短?
6. ECC在资源受限的设备上有哪些优势?
7. ECC在哪些领域得到了广泛应用?
8. ECC与区块链技术有何关联?
9. ECC是否能够抵御侧信道攻击?
10. ECC的未来发展趋势如何?
详细解答:
1. 什么是ECC?
ECC(Elliptic Curve Cryptography)是一种基于椭圆曲线数学的公钥加密算法,具有高效、安全等特点。
2. ECC与RSA相比有哪些优势?
与RSA相比,ECC在相同的密钥长度下,加密和解密速度更快,资源消耗更低,安全性更高。
3. ECC的安全性如何?
ECC的理论基础较为坚实,具有较好的抗量子计算攻击能力,能够抵御量子计算机的潜在威胁。
4. ECC在量子计算机威胁下是否安全?
是的,ECC具有较强的抗量子计算能力,能够抵御量子计算机的潜在威胁。
5. ECC的密钥长度为什么较短?
ECC的密钥长度较短,可以在保证安全性的前提下,降低密钥管理的难度。
6. ECC在资源受限的设备上有哪些优势?
ECC在计算过程中对计算资源和存储空间的要求较低,适用于资源受限的设备。
7. ECC在哪些领域得到了广泛应用?
ECC在移动通信、物联网、云计算等领域得到了广泛应用。
8. ECC与区块链技术有何关联?
ECC是区块链技术中常用的加密算法之一,能够保证区块链的安全性。
9. ECC是否能够抵御侧信道攻击?
是的,ECC具有较强的抗侧信道攻击能力,能够保护信息安全。
10. ECC的未来发展趋势如何?
随着量子计算机的不断发展,ECC在密码学领域的地位将更加重要。未来,ECC可能会与其他加密算法结合,形成更加安全的加密体系。